[ARVADOS] updated: 1.3.0-1238-g73b441efb
Git user
git at public.curoverse.com
Mon Jul 1 21:51:20 UTC 2019
Summary of changes:
tools/arvbox/lib/arvbox/docker/api-setup.sh | 1 +
tools/arvbox/lib/arvbox/docker/go-setup.sh | 3 +++
tools/arvbox/lib/arvbox/docker/service/controller/run | 2 --
3 files changed, 4 insertions(+), 2 deletions(-)
via 73b441efbc65110e131213bef7061dbd4070bfd2 (commit)
from e95c41c6a9ee3d1c01c31fa35d08eeadd440c24f (commit)
Those revisions listed above that are new to this repository have
not appeared on any other notification email; so we list those
revisions in full, below.
commit 73b441efbc65110e131213bef7061dbd4070bfd2
Author: Peter Amstutz <pamstutz at veritasgenetics.com>
Date: Mon Jul 1 17:50:31 2019 -0400
Tweak arvbox build order, API server depends on arvados-server
refs #14812
Arvados-DCO-1.1-Signed-off-by: Peter Amstutz <pamstutz at veritasgenetics.com>
diff --git a/tools/arvbox/lib/arvbox/docker/api-setup.sh b/tools/arvbox/lib/arvbox/docker/api-setup.sh
index c81eb908b..a64f2f928 100755
--- a/tools/arvbox/lib/arvbox/docker/api-setup.sh
+++ b/tools/arvbox/lib/arvbox/docker/api-setup.sh
@@ -7,6 +7,7 @@ exec 2>&1
set -ex -o pipefail
. /usr/local/lib/arvbox/common.sh
+. /usr/local/lib/arvbox/go-setup.sh
cd /usr/src/arvados/services/api
diff --git a/tools/arvbox/lib/arvbox/docker/go-setup.sh b/tools/arvbox/lib/arvbox/docker/go-setup.sh
index f068ce684..cdd7298da 100644
--- a/tools/arvbox/lib/arvbox/docker/go-setup.sh
+++ b/tools/arvbox/lib/arvbox/docker/go-setup.sh
@@ -14,3 +14,6 @@ flock /var/lib/gopath/gopath.lock go get -t github.com/kardianos/govendor
cd "$GOPATH/src/git.curoverse.com/arvados.git"
flock /var/lib/gopath/gopath.lock go get -v -d ...
flock /var/lib/gopath/gopath.lock "$GOPATH/bin/govendor" sync
+
+flock /var/lib/gopath/gopath.lock go get -t "git.curoverse.com/arvados.git/cmd/arvados-server"
+install $GOPATH/bin/arvados-server /usr/local/bin
diff --git a/tools/arvbox/lib/arvbox/docker/service/controller/run b/tools/arvbox/lib/arvbox/docker/service/controller/run
index 986ad8496..799fc63e1 100755
--- a/tools/arvbox/lib/arvbox/docker/service/controller/run
+++ b/tools/arvbox/lib/arvbox/docker/service/controller/run
@@ -9,8 +9,6 @@ set -ex -o pipefail
. /usr/local/lib/arvbox/common.sh
. /usr/local/lib/arvbox/go-setup.sh
-flock /var/lib/gopath/gopath.lock go get -t "git.curoverse.com/arvados.git/cmd/arvados-server"
-install $GOPATH/bin/arvados-server /usr/local/bin
(cd /usr/local/bin && ln -sf arvados-server arvados-controller)
if test "$1" = "--only-deps" ; then
-----------------------------------------------------------------------
hooks/post-receive
--
More information about the arvados-commits
mailing list